  • Palmer: Nestled at the base of Lazy Mountain, Palmer is a charming city known for its stunning outdoor scenery and adventurous spirit. The area sees a burst of travelers from June to August, drawn by the lush landscapes and recreational opportunities. Popular activities include hiking trails and campgrounds, making it a haven for nature enthusiasts. Don't miss the nearby national parks and breathtaking mountain views, which offer perfect backdrops for photography and exploration.
  • Butte: Just 6 miles from Lazy Mountain, Butte is a quaint village that beckons visitors with its beautiful outdoor scenery. Like Palmer, it experiences peak tourist activity from June to August. Butte is ideal for hiking and outdoor adventures, with easy access to local lakes and national parks. The village's tranquil atmosphere allows for a peaceful getaway after a day of exploration, making it a great spot to unwind and enjoy nature.
  • Farm Loop: Located 7 miles from Lazy Mountain, Farm Loop offers a delightful escape into Alaska's natural beauty. This village is popular among adventurers and outdoor enthusiasts, especially during the summer months. With its hiking trails and campgrounds, Farm Loop is perfect for those looking to immerse themselves in the wilderness. The area also features skiing opportunities in the winter and is home to local museums that showcase the region's rich history.

Shopping

In Lazy Mountain, explore local shops for unique gifts and souvenirs. If you're up for a drive, visit the Wasilla Mall, located about 15 miles away, offering a range of stores, including popular retail chains and specialty shops.

Recreation

At Palmer Golf Course, indulge in a round of golf surrounded by breathtaking views and a vibrant outdoor atmosphere. This 18-hole course, located 5 miles from Lazy Mountain, offers a perfect blend of relaxation and recreation, making it an ideal spot for wellness and leisure activities.

Adventure

Hike the Bodenburg Butte Trail, located 7 miles from Lazy Mountain, for breathtaking scenery and an exhilarating outdoor experience. Alternatively, explore Twin Peaks Trail, 16 miles away, offering stunning views and adventure. For family fun, camp at Matanuska Lakes State Recreation Area, just 9 miles from Lazy Mountain.

  • Lazy Mountain: Experience the great outdoors at Lazy Mountain, where adventure awaits. This stunning mountain offers breathtaking scenery and numerous hiking trails, making it perfect for outdoor enthusiasts looking to connect with nature.
  • Palmer Visitor Information Center: Located 6 miles away, this center provides a glimpse into the rich culture and history of the Palmer area. Explore informative exhibits and gather tips for your local adventures.
  • Colony House Museum: Also situated 6 miles from Lazy Mountain, this historic house allows visitors to step back in time. Discover the cultural heritage of the region and enjoy the charming architecture that reflects early Alaskan life.

What is the best area to stay in Lazy Mountain?
The best area to stay in Lazy Mountain is typically around the base of Lazy Mountain itself, particularly in the residential areas that offer views of the Matanuska Valley and convenient access to outdoor activities.

This area is characterized by spacious properties, often with direct trail access, and a more remote, scenic setting compared to more urban locations. You'll find a mix of private vacation rentals and a few lodges scattered along the roads leading up the mountain's lower slopes, such as Lazy Mountain Road.

For couples seeking a peaceful retreat, this area is ideal. Many properties offer private decks or patios with expansive views, superb for enjoying the Alaskan scenery and wildlife spotting. It provides a quiet escape with opportunities for hiking and photography right from your doorstep.

Families will also appreciate the space and outdoor opportunities available here. With larger properties and access to trails, children have room to explore, and the natural surroundings offer a refreshing change of pace.
